AI Insight: SGHT Ratio Trends
Q1 2026 margin collapse reverses Q4 2025's apparent recovery, with OpMargin plunging to -63.0% and ROIC deteriorating to -52.6%.
• Operating margin swung from -18.0% in Q4 2025 to -63.0% in Q1 2026, erasing the sharpest improvement seen in the dataset.
• ROE deepened to -96.3% in Q1 2026 from -26.0% in Q4 2025, the worst reading across all periods shown.
• D/E ratio has risen steadily from 0.33 in Q2 2024 to 0.75 in Q1 2026, signaling increasing leverage over the period.
• Q4 2025 showed a genuine sequential improvement—OpMargin improved from -79.2% in Q1 2025 to -18.0%—suggesting strong seasonality.
⚠ Q1 seasonality appears severe; whether Q2 2026 rebounds toward Q4 2025 levels is the key inflection to monitor.
⚠ ROIC hit -52.6% in Q1 2026, worse than any prior quarter, raising questions about capital efficiency as leverage rises.
⚠ D/E at 0.75 is the highest on record here; continued cash burn with rising debt could pressure the balance sheet.

Which hedge funds own SGHT?
Institutional investors are required to disclose their holdings quarterly via SEC Form 13F. 13F Pro aggregates these filings to show which hedge funds, mutual funds, and asset managers are buying or selling SGHT.
